Newcastle United will be seeking for additional players to add depth to their squad ahead of their Champions League campaign next season, and a new update on a prospective transfer target has emerged.

What’s the latest on Newcastle United’s pursuit of Federico Chiesa?

Newcastle has made a bid for Juventus winger Federico Chiesa, according to the Italian publication Corriere della Sera (via Sport Witness).

According to the source, Chiesa is interested in a move to St James’ Park this summer after rejecting down a move to Aston Villa. However, despite a reported proposal, there is no indication of a transfer value or how far Newcastle are willing to go to win his signature this summer.

What makes Chiesa so special?

There is no doubt that Eddie Howe will be delighted with the rapid progress and success delivered by his current crop of Newcastle players; however, with a long-awaited return to Champions League football on the horizon, it would be advantageous to bring in some more European competition experience.

The Magpies have already secured the signing of Sandro Tonali to provide additional depth to their midfield presence ahead of next season, and the focus now appears to be on reinforcing the attacking line, with Leicester City’s Harvey Barnes also allegedly a target.

As a result, the signing of Chiesa would be a great piece of business given his clear talent and quality, as well as the advantage over Barnes in having a wealth of experience in playing on the European stage for Juventus.

Despite his injury struggles over the last 18 months, the Italian winger has been a stand-out performer in Europe for the Serie A giants with 25 appearances tallied up over the Europa and Champions League, as well as eight goals and three assists in those respective competitions.

Now Howe could benefit from adding another Italian whiz into his squad and from his midfield role, Tonali could be an incredible partner for Chiesa should his international teammate join him in the North East.

Whilst Newcastle already boasts the talents of Joelinton and Bruno Guimaraes, Tonali is an exceptional presence in the centre of the pitch and will make a huge impact on the attacking threat next season.

As per FBref, the newly-signed Newcastle dynamo ranks in the top 10% of his positional peers across the top five European leagues over the last 12 months for assists, as well as ranking in the top 25% for progressive carries and shot-creating actions per 90 minutes played, demonstrating that he is a reliable creative outlet.

Meanwhile, Chiesa – who was once hailed a “joy to watch” by journalist Josh Bunting – ranks in the top 20% of his positional peers for total shots, assists and progressive carries per 90 over the last 12 months, so he could really benefit from Tonali’s creativity to make an instant impact in the Newcastle forward line and boost goal contributions across all competitions.

Despite a reported offer from Newcastle, it is reported that Juventus are demanding a transfer fee of €60 million (£51 million) this summer, which could prove difficult for the Magpies due to Financial Fair Play restrictions limiting their ability to spend heavily, so a move for Chiesa would likely necessitate the sale of another player in the squad.

Having said that, if Newcastle can sign Chiesa this summer, it will demonstrate their ambitious ambition to contend comfortably in the Champions League next season, as well as provide Howe with another excellent player to employ in the final third.
